You'll need a reamer to mount it over the knuckles. I put it underneath because I was to lazy. LOL! Just keep in mind if your using a thick or slider/add-on style diff cover it may rub. The straightness of the kit unlike the bends in the OEM stuff may limit steering a little. I haven't notched my diff cover yet but need to. It's already taking a lot of hits and seems to be holding up well. I'm also running the stock like trackbar.
